[][src]Trait ul::UltralightAppOverlay

pub trait UltralightAppOverlay {
    fn overlay_get_view(&mut self) -> Result<View, NoneError>;
fn overlay_get_height(&mut self) -> Result<u32, NoneError>;
fn overlay_get_width(&mut self) -> Result<u32, NoneError>;
fn overlay_get_x(&mut self) -> Result<i32, NoneError>;
fn overlay_get_y(&mut self) -> Result<i32, NoneError>;
fn overlay_focus(&mut self) -> Result<(), NoneError>;
fn overlay_unfocus(&mut self) -> Result<(), NoneError>;
fn overlay_has_focus(&mut self) -> Result<bool, NoneError>;
fn overlay_hide(&mut self) -> Result<(), NoneError>;
fn overlay_is_hidden(&mut self) -> Result<bool, NoneError>;
fn overlay_move_to(&self, x: i32, y: i32) -> Result<(), NoneError>;
fn overlay_resize(&self, width: u32, height: u32) -> Result<(), NoneError>; }

Required methods

fn overlay_get_view(&mut self) -> Result<View, NoneError>

fn overlay_get_height(&mut self) -> Result<u32, NoneError>

fn overlay_get_width(&mut self) -> Result<u32, NoneError>

fn overlay_get_x(&mut self) -> Result<i32, NoneError>

fn overlay_get_y(&mut self) -> Result<i32, NoneError>

fn overlay_focus(&mut self) -> Result<(), NoneError>

fn overlay_unfocus(&mut self) -> Result<(), NoneError>

fn overlay_has_focus(&mut self) -> Result<bool, NoneError>

fn overlay_hide(&mut self) -> Result<(), NoneError>

fn overlay_is_hidden(&mut self) -> Result<bool, NoneError>

fn overlay_move_to(&self, x: i32, y: i32) -> Result<(), NoneError>

fn overlay_resize(&self, width: u32, height: u32) -> Result<(), NoneError>

Loading content...

Implementors

impl<'a> UltralightAppOverlay for UltralightApp<'a>[src]

Loading content...